Output ce2a1f81e88062d1f983a9c8e5d1d2ecb7cd730ecec45f37ac4c8b5bf006a83a:24

value
655173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a3c80d1f23b3408ec34d64e01423fd9c5359374 OP_EQUAL
address
3QW9LLY4rL8vmgaKQPhmnbcifjJMEyEBYT
transaction
ce2a1f81e88062d1f983a9c8e5d1d2ecb7cd730ecec45f37ac4c8b5bf006a83a
spent
true